Surprising Statistics About Car Crashes

In our automobile-centric society, car crashes are never too far from our minds. Especially with winter weather having set in, navigating the perils of hazardous roads is part of every responsible driver’s basic responsibilities. One of the best ways to prevent accidents is by awareness of what causes them. To this end, we’d like to share a few surprising car crash statistics.

Surprising Statistics About Car Crashes

These car crash statistics might surprise you.

The Third Leading Cause of Death in the U.S.

According to the CDC, ‘accidents’ stand as the third leading cause of death in the United States. A majority of these result from car crashes. You are nearly as likely to die in such an accident as you are from heart disease or cancer. This is not to mention the magnitudes of people who sustain life-altering injuries.

A Fatal Crash Occurs Every Sixteen Minutes

In case the first of our car crash statistics was not enough, consider this one: an American dies in a car crash every sixteen minutes on average. This equates to about 90 deaths per day. Even among individuals who survive severe accidents, they account for more medical costs than any other form of personal injury.

Most Occur Near Home

When people think of car crashes, they might tend to think of those that take place while on long-distance drives. You might want to rethink this conception, as statistics show that a majority of crashes occur near the home of the victim.

Although, you should keep in mind that this correlation might have more to do with the fact that a majority of people’s driving takes place on their daily commutes or other errands around town. The lesson here is that you should always be alert.

Drunk Driving the Leading Cause

Losing a loved one or sustaining severe injuries from a car crash can be immensely painful. That pain can be made worse by the knowledge that it was the result of another’s negligence or reckless behavior. Sadly, this is all too often the case. Statistics suggest that the leading cause of car crashes is drunk driving. This is followed by other avoidable reckless behaviors such as speeding or distracted driving.
